#include "tst_qmediarecorder_xa.h"
#include "tst_qmediarecorder_xa_macros.h"

void tst_QMediaRecorder::testAudioAmr()
{
    QSignalSpy stateSignal(audiocapture,SIGNAL(stateChanged(QMediaRecorder::State)));
    audiocapture->setOutputLocation(nextFileName(QDir::rootPath(), "", "amr"));
    QAudioEncoderSettings audioSettings;
    audioSettings.setCodec("amr");
    audioSettings.setSampleRate(-1);
    QVideoEncoderSettings videoSettings;
    audiocapture->setEncodingSettings(audioSettings, videoSettings, QString("audio/amr"));
    QCOMPARE(audiocapture->state(), QMediaRecorder::StoppedState);
    QTest::qWait(500);  // wait for recorder to initialize itself
    audiocapture->record();
    QTRY_COMPARE(stateSignal.count(), 1); // wait for callbacks to complete in symbian API
    QCOMPARE(audiocapture->state(), QMediaRecorder::RecordingState);
    QCOMPARE(audiocapture->error(), QMediaRecorder::NoError);
    QCOMPARE(audiocapture->errorString(), QString());
    QCOMPARE(stateSignal.count(), 1);
    QTest::qWait(5000);  // wait for 5 seconds
    audiocapture->pause();
    QTRY_COMPARE(stateSignal.count(), 2); // wait for callbacks to complete in symbian API
    QCOMPARE(audiocapture->state(), QMediaRecorder::PausedState);
    QCOMPARE(stateSignal.count(), 2);
    audiocapture->stop();
    QTRY_COMPARE(stateSignal.count(), 3); // wait for callbacks to complete in symbian API
    QCOMPARE(audiocapture->state(), QMediaRecorder::StoppedState);
    QCOMPARE(stateSignal.count(), 3);
}

void tst_QMediaRecorder::testAudioAmrStereo()
{
    QSignalSpy errorSignal(audiocapture,SIGNAL(error(QMediaRecorder::Error)));
    audiocapture->setOutputLocation(nextFileName(QDir::rootPath(), "Stereo", "amr"));
    QAudioEncoderSettings audioSettings;
    audioSettings.setCodec("amr");
    audioSettings.setSampleRate(-1);
    audioSettings.setChannelCount(2);
    QVideoEncoderSettings videoSettings;
    audiocapture->setEncodingSettings(audioSettings, videoSettings, QString("audio/amr"));
    QCOMPARE(audiocapture->state(), QMediaRecorder::StoppedState);
    QTest::qWait(500);  // wait for recorder to initialize itself
    audiocapture->record();
    QTRY_COMPARE(errorSignal.count(), 1); // wait for callbacks to complete in symbian API
    QCOMPARE(audiocapture->error(), QMediaRecorder::ResourceError);
    QCOMPARE(audiocapture->errorString(), QString("Generic error"));
}

void tst_QMediaRecorder::testAudioAmrSr16kHz()
{
    QSignalSpy errorSignal(audiocapture,SIGNAL(error(QMediaRecorder::Error)));
    audiocapture->setOutputLocation(nextFileName(QDir::rootPath(), "Sr16kHz", "amr"));
    QAudioEncoderSettings audioSettings;
    audioSettings.setCodec("amr");
    audioSettings.setEncodingMode(QtMultimedia::ConstantBitRateEncoding);
    audioSettings.setSampleRate(16000);
    QVideoEncoderSettings videoSettings;
    audiocapture->setEncodingSettings(audioSettings, videoSettings, QString("audio/amr"));
    QCOMPARE(audiocapture->state(), QMediaRecorder::StoppedState);
    QTest::qWait(500);  // wait for recorder to initialize itself
    audiocapture->record();
    QTRY_COMPARE(errorSignal.count(), 1); // wait for callbacks to complete in symbian API
    QCOMPARE(audiocapture->error(), QMediaRecorder::ResourceError);
    QCOMPARE(audiocapture->errorString(), QString("Generic error"));
}
